Cambodia Yacht Charter

The Kingdom of Cambodia, as it is officially known, is a beautiful holiday and charter destination situated in the southern portion of the Indochina Peninsula in Southeast Asia between Vietnam, Laos, Thailand and the Gulf of Thailand. The pure, clean beaches and the beautiful islands, rich culture and a great history make the Cambodian Coastline & Islands a great place to sail while on a South East Asia yacht charter.

Cambodia boasts several natural advantages that make her the ideal maritime playground including beautiful islands, untouched coral reefs which shelter a myraid of tropical fish and marine life, friendly people, a fascinating culture and fabulous food. Cambodia is a majestic and mysterious paradise that provides a luxury yacht charter experience like no other. From cloud-capped mountain peaks to a rich jungle paradise to the pure clean white beaches lined with green palm trees, Cambodia is sure to impress.

Cambodia also provides superb sailing conditions in a warm tropical climate, with consistent trade winds blowing 10 to 15 knots all year round. The idyllic sailing destination of Cambodia covers some 100 nautical miles of tropical coastline, with pristine bays, and around 30 beautiful islands to explore from Koh Kong in the north to Koh Wai the southern outer most islands.

Cambodia as yacht charter destination also offers a rich history and culture. From the incredible majesty of Angkor Wat temple to the Tuol Sleng Genocide Museum in Phnom Penh that remembers the countries brutal past, to the pristine beaches and kind Cambodian people, Cambodia offers something to suit everyone’s sense of adventure while on a luxury yacht charter.

Chartering a yacht in Cambodia

A destination not to be missed while on a luxury yacht charter in Cambodia is the port city of Sihanoukville which features white sand beaches and lush tropical islands just off the coast. Sihanoukville has Cambodia’s principal deep-water maritime port and is surrounded on 3 sides by the Bay of Thailand.

Sihanoukville Cambodia during the day

Sihanoukville Cambodia at sunset

While of your yacht charter in Sihanoukville, enjoy swimming and sun bathing, trips to the islands, fishing, and snorkelling and scuba diving. Onshore you can visit one of the many themed restaurants and bars, owned by people from all over the world.  Buddhist temples, mountain biking, dirt biking, walking around the central market, shopping, and seeing the Cambodian culture are also popular activities.

Next destination to move in Cambodia through the yacht charter is Kampot. This small town is a blend of Cambodian, French, and Chinese architecture. The tranquil atmosphere of the place is the factor which draws the attention of the tourists.

Koh Hong is yet another ‘not be missed’ place in Cambodia when you have set out to explore the country while you are on yacht charter. Still untouched by mankind, this natural wonderland offers provides Eco tourism as one of the specialities of the place. Other yachting destinations to be experienced on a yacht charter holiday tour in the Kingdom of Cambodia are Kep and Rabbit Island.

Cambodia has plenty of islands in front of Sihanoukville's, Kep's and Koh Kong's coast, but just a few of them have basic development. Most of them are still untouched which make them the perfect place to explore from the comfort of a luxury motor yacht or sailing yacht.

So be among the lucky few that get to experience cruising on a yacht in Cambodia. Enjoy island hopping, diving, fishing, trekking to waterfalls in the rain forest, and exploring the wonderful tropical island paradises. Thick with jungle and teeming with marine life, Cambodia is a yachting destination well-suited for outdoor enthusiasts and pleasure-seekers alike.

Other Attractions in Cambodia

Other than yachting, other places to enjoy in Cambodia inlcude Kirirom national park which is located in Phnom Sruoch district. The place is home to animals like Asian elephant, tiger, leopard, spotted Linsang, deer, Pileated Gibbon, and Gaur. The place also has many lakes and waterfalls.

Another attraction of the Kingdom of Cambodia is the Bokor Hill Station where you can see the Bokor palace hotel. You can also go to the caves near Kampot, formed of limestone they display very interesting formations of rocks. Also, the pepper plantation in Kampot should not be missed when you are there.

The capital and largest city of Cambodia is Phnom Penh, located on the banks of the Mekong River. Founded in 1434, and once known as the pearl of Asia, the city is noted for its beautiful and historical architecture and attractions. There is a number of surviving French colonial buildings scattered along the grand boulevards and the royal palace is located here. It is the country’s commercial, economic and political hub. A mixture of Cambodian hospitality, Asian exotica and Indochinese charm await tourist who visit to Phnom Penh.
